Bulfinch Hotel, expensive, (617) 624-0202,
www.bulfinchhotel.com. It's true that the rooms at
this year-old boutique hotel in an old flatiron-shaped warehouse
aren't what you'd call spacious, but with the North End, the State
House, and other area landmarks less than a 10-minute walk away,
we're guessing you won't be spending much time there, anyway. Plus,
the rates go down this time of year.
